Hilbert High is a State/Public serving high age pupils, located in Hilbert, Calumet County. The school has 140 pupils enrolled. It is part of the Hilbert School District school district. It serves grades 9โ12 in a rural setting. The school employs 13.2 full-time-equivalent teachers, a student-teacher ratio of 10.7:1. 25% of students are proficient in reading. 35% are proficient in maths. The four-year graduation rate is 95%. The school offers 6 AP courses, dual enrollment, a gifted and talented program. Technology infrastructure includes fiber internet, campus-wide Wi-Fi, devices for students.
Hilbert High enrolls 140 students across grades 9โ12. The student body is 50% male and 50% female. A teaching staff of 13.2 full-time-equivalent teachers supports the school, giving a student-teacher ratio of 10.7:1.
By race and ethnicity, the student body is 83% White, 14% Hispanic or Latino and 2.1% Two or more races.

37 of the school's 140 students (26%) q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. Of these, 31 qualify for free lunch and 6 for a reduced price. The school participates in the National School Lunch Program. Free and reduced-price lunch eligibility is a widely used indicator of the share of students from lower-income households.
Hilbert High is located in a rural setting (NCES locale: Rural, Distant). Virtual instruction: Supplemental Virtual. For civic and policy purposes, the school sits in congressional district WI-80, state senate district 9, state house district 25.
Hilbert High is one of 3 schools in Hilbert School District, based in Hilbert, Wisconsin. The district serves 481 students district-wide and employs 37 full-time-equivalent teachers. With 140 students, Hilbert High is close to the district average of about 160 students per school.
